2002 Citroen C-Airdream vs. 1958 Wartburg 312

To start off, 2002 Citroen C-Airdream is newer by 44 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1958 Wartburg 312.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1958 Wartburg 312 would be higher. At 2,946 cc (6 cylinders), 2002 Citroen C-Airdream is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Citroen C-Airdream (208 HP) has 159 more horse power than 1958 Wartburg 312. (49 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2002 Citroen C-Airdream should accelerate faster than 1958 Wartburg 312.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Citroen C-Airdream weights approximately 20 kg more than 1958 Wartburg 312.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2002 Citroen C-Airdream (284 Nm @ 3750 RPM) has 186 more torque (in Nm) than 1958 Wartburg 312. (98 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2002 Citroen C-Airdream will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1958 Wartburg 312.
